Abstract:

Drought risk management needs drought risk analysis. Dry spells, or the number of days without rainfall, is a drought index which is important for risk analysis and management planning. In this study, annual maximum dry spell of 31 stations of isfahan province were gathered for regional risk analysis . after trend analysis distribution functions were fitted to observed series and Logistic distribution and generalized extreme values distributions were found as the best regional distributions. The results of his study showed that the average dry spell of the province is 148 days. They also showed that eastern and southern rerions are at higher risk that other regions. However , in the higher return periods, the risk is almost equal for the entire region and is equal to 60 to 85% of the year.
